We have had issues with Matplotlib before when the figure size is pushed to 0 in one or both directions (because that is not a super useful use case it does not get a lot of exercise). ipympl should probably not be setting the figure size to 0, but the core library. Nov 04, 2021 · Some possible solutions: Libpng 1.6 and above enhances ICC profiles checking, so a warning is issued. Delete ICCP profiles from PNG images. You can read it first and then save it again: import cv2 from skimage import io image = io.imread(path) image = cv2.cvtColor(image, cv2.COLOR_RGBA2BGRA) cv2.imencode('.png',image) .tofile(path) solution .... C++ deprecated conversion from string constant to 'char*'. Determine if two rectangles overlap each other? libpng warning: iCCP: known incorrect sRGB profile. Does delete on a pointer to a subclass call the base class destructor? Mutex example / tutorial? What is the 'override' keyword in C++ used for?. Implicitly libpng needs the math library on some systems i.e. Solaris - so it will link as shared (the math library is linked to libpng) but it will fail the package check as a static library. I see this same, or similar pattern in 57 packages currently on master, with various filters for the "os" setting. Re: dolphin-emu Warning - iCCP: known incorrect sRGB profile. Find the pngs for the program in question (pacman -Ql <pkgname>), then run "identify" on them. It will tell you which pngs have the old/incorrect sRGB profiles. I see you have GiMP installed, open one of the pngs up with that and go to Image | Image Properties | Color Profile to see. Libpng 1.6 and above enhances ICC profiles checking, so a warning is issued. Delete ICCP profiles from PNG images. You can read it first and then save it again: import cv2 from skimage import io image = io.imread(path) image = cv2.cvtColor(image, cv2.COLOR_RGBA2BGRA) cv2.imencode('.png',image) .tofile(path) solution. Python Kivy Gridlayout错误：未设置列或行，布局未触发,python,kivy,Python,Kivy ... <No errors.> [INFO ] [Window ] auto add sdl2 input provider libpng warning: iCCP: known incorrect sRGB profile [INFO ] [Window ] virtual keyboard not allowed, single mode, not docked [INFO ] [Base ] Start application main loop [INFO ] [GL ] NPOT. The reason for this is that the new version of libpng has enhanced checks and issues a warning. This warning can be ignored. To remove this warning use the v4 color configuration. GIMPsRGB v4 color profile, modify the color profile of the current image, set to default. On this page you will find several different types of sRGB profiles, with .... Help pour erreur python libpng warning Liste des forums; Rechercher dans le forum. Partage. Help pour erreur python libpng warning. aToXNoptil 1 juin 2017 à 18:03:31. Bonsoir, quelqu'un pourrait m'expliquer cette erreur : "libpng warning : Interlace handling should be turned on when using png_read_image". J'ai déjà essayer de passer toutes. In libpng-1.4.x, which was meant to be a transitional release, members of the png_struct and the info_struct can still be accessed, but the compiler will issue a warning about deprecated usage. Since libpng-1.5.0, direct access to these structs is not allowed, and the definitions of the structs reside in private pngstruct.h and pnginfo.h header files that are not. I stumbled appon a warning message that was thrown by PHP when handling images with GD lib (e.g. imagecreatefrompng()). The message shown. (Slightly experimentally) running the png module as a command line tool, with python -m png, will report the version and file location of the png module. Release 0.0.20. Support for earlier versions of Python is dropped. Python 3.4 and onwards are supported. Python 2.7 also works, but this is the last release to support any version of Python 2. Libpng warning: iCCP: known incorrect sRGB profile. Some .png images used in pygame may get the warning read as "libpng warning: iCCP: known incorrect sRGB profile".To solve this I have searched and found the solution by using ImageMagick.After installing, single file can be fixed by calling convert <in_img> -strip <out_img>, but to make it fixes every wanted images in path we'll need to. warnings — Warning control ¶ Source code: Lib/warnings.py Warning messages are typically issued in situations where it is useful to alert the user of some condition in a program, where that condition (normally) doesn't warrant raising an exception and terminating the program. The newest libpng update (1.6.2 I believe?) has stricter rules about iCCP and will print this warning every time it finds a png that is broken. This warning can be ignored. Fixes would include: Downgrade to a older version of libpng. Install imagemagick and convert all .png files with convert -strip (script below).
bonus codes for votes on bidiboo